Well, if you created a partition on a hard drive with no partition, or removed a partition and created a new one, then you have to completely format it (normal speed), because there is no file system so the whole file system has to be created.
If there is already a partition on the hard drive with a file system and you just want to re-install windows on it, then you can use quick format. As there is already a file system only the table of contents needs to be cleared so that the partition will be empty. Just use quick format. If quick format is not possible Windows will tell you that. RJ
